26 U.S.C. § 5065

Territorial extent of law

Official textgovinfo.govlast amended

The provisions of this part imposing taxes on distilled spirits, wines, and beer shall be held to extend to such articles produced anywhere within the exterior boundaries of the United States, whether the same be within an internal revenue district or not.
